VOICE: Sculpting Resistance

Expressing observations, obsessions, fears, dreams, and desires, this sculpture collection navigates the space between perception and reality. Further, it examines the overreaching influence of external forces like the government, media, money, and religion on the "fabric of us." VOICE offers a tangible reflection on our shared humanity and the complex forces shaping our individual and collective identities.

BEYOND YOUR JURISDICTION / $425 / 8.5”W X 5.5”H X 6.5”D

(commentary on the violation of woman’s rights)

This sculpture confronts the issue of governmental overreach into women's reproductive rights. It visually articulates the sense of violation and intrusion experienced when men in positions of power legislate control over women's bodies, disregarding their autonomy and lived experiences. The gritty texture of the piece, achieved through the use of a red, coarse-grog clay, directly enhances its conceptual meaning.

FLUFF / $375 (PAIR) / 6.5”W X 7.5”H X 4.5”D

(a commentary on personal truth/vulnerability)

These works invite contemplation on sexuality as a powerful and diverse form of human expression, one that holds the potential for profound celebration. The sculptures subtly imply that negative or "prudish" societal views are often the root cause of the discomfort, judgment, and even oppression that can surround this natural aspect of human experience.

Beneath their sweet, candy-colored, glossy surfaces, the figures exhibit expressions of despair and loneliness, underscoring the darker aspects of desire, objectification, and the commodification of the body.
